A Colorful Beginning
Super Lesbian Caribou stood gracefully on the balcony of her castle, the splendid orange walls glistening in the morning sun. Her city, Tundra Wood, buzzed below, as humans and humanoid animals mingled in their daily lives.
She adjusted her purple super suit and flicked her orange cape back, her blue gloves catching the sunlight as she did so. "Something feels odd today," she mused, noting the absence of the usual shimmer from the rainbow orbs that decorated the city. These orbs, vibrant and colorful, were rumored to have an enchanting quality that lifted everyone's spirits.
Lost in thought, she watched a group of children playing in the street, their laughter musical. Unbeknownst to them, shadows of a new mystery were gently creeping into their color-filled world. Her duty was clear, though the depths of the challenge yet unknown.
The Suspicious Tower
Super Lesbian Caribou felt the urge to investigate further. The city needed her help. She launched herself gracefully into the air, letting the familiar wind tug at her orange cape.
As she flew over Tundra Wood City, a strange glow caught her eye. It came from near the city center, a pyramid-like structure that hadn't been there last week. The glow was curious, almost inviting.
She landed softly in front of the structure and peered closely. "Who could have built this?" she wondered aloud.
"Ah, you've noticed!" a voice rang out. Startled, she turned and saw a walking stick standing upright. "I'm Barkley," the stick spoke with a slight bow, wooden features giving him a distinctive, wise air.
"You're alive?" she gasped. "And talking!"
Barkley nodded, "But I don't walk much. This pyramid has secrets about those rainbow orbs. We should work together."
Super Lesbian Caribou considered his offer, seeing potential in the partnership.
